Anna Murphy receives so many death threats, she's become friends with the Calgary police officer she reports them to.
As a transgender woman in the public eye, she's subjected to an avalanche of hate — one that she and other community members and experts say has intensified in recent years, underscoring the need for protest alongside celebration during Pride.
But despite the support she receives, Murphy, who is a community organizer, says the constant stream of vitriol is exhausting. There's been a similar uptick in hate crimes targeting people for their sexual orientation: in 2021 there were 423 reported incidents, compared to 176 in 2016, StatCan data show.
Just this week, a man at a school track meet in Kelowna, B.C., made headlines for wrongly suggesting a nine-year-old girl was transgender and demanding proof she was born biologically female. The girl's mother says a woman who was with the man accused her of being a groomer and "genital mutilator.
